I have been running a Davis Instruments Corp. Vantage Pro 2 posting weather data to Wunderground since 2006. As eager as I was to keep the system running 24/7; I found myself needing a Computer Solution that would do the task of retrieving data from the console and posting the data to the internet with a smaller Carbon Footprint. So in October of 2009 I moved my Ambient Weather program and data off a power hungry Sony Vaio of which its power suppy is rated at 150 Watts . The Fit-PC2 made my setup GREENER by utilizing only 8 watts. For an 'Information System' that was intended to work 24/7, this reduced my power consumption by 1875%. This is just an example of how this palm sized wonder will work. Do you have a home or small business PC that needs to be on 24/7 as a web server, media hub, Database, weather station?
